image I want to change the values in the config file to increase training speed, is it possible? @pythonlessons

DucBac99 avatar Oct 20 '23 07:10 DucBac99

it really depends on your machine, if your GPU is used 100% batch size and workers number will not help, then you need to change model architecture or input size or other stuff

image I noticed that if I trained more than 100 times, I would get this error. I also tried searching the val.csv file in the model and only got 1726 records while my dataset had more than 20 thousand images. image @pythonlessons please help me

DucBac99 avatar Oct 21 '23 02:10 DucBac99

You received this error, because you try to convert model to onnx, but your GPU is too old to support it. You need to convert it manually using cpu onnx version. Your 20k images dataset should be split into train and validation, check how much data you had in your train.csv

oh no friend. I have fixed the error and trained with GPU, but when I train I am encountering an Early stopping error. I will train again and send you specific images. Hope you will help me

DucBac99 avatar Oct 27 '23 09:10 DucBac99

Early stopping is not an error, its a function, if you model is not learning enough, increase early stopping patience, try playing around with learning rate or even model. Maybe you images are hard to crack
